9-62. Cranking Motors. (Delco-Remy)
W
9-63. General. When the cranking motor switch is closed, the armature begins to rotate The drie pinion.
being a loose fit on the drive sleeve located on the armature shaft. does not pick up speed as fast as the
armature Therefore. the drive pinion. having internally matched splines with respect to the splines drne
sleeve. moves endwise on the shaft and into mesh with the flwheel As the pinion hits the pinion stop. it begins
to rotate with the armature and cranks the engine
When the engine starts. the flywheel begins to spin the pinion faster than the armature Again. because
of the splined action of the pinion and drive sleeve assembly. the pinion backs out of mesh with the 11! wheel
ring gear protecting the armature from excessive speeds.
Some Bendix drives incorporate a small anti-drift spring between the drive pinion and the pinion stop
which pre ents the pinion from drifting into mesh when the engine is running. Others use a smallanti-drift pin
and spring inside the pinion which provides enough friction to keep the pinion from drifting into mesh
Nexer operate the motor for more than 30 seconds without pausing for two minutes to allow it to cool
9-64 Checking Cranking Motor. Several checks. both visual and electrical, should be made in a defective
cranking circuit to isolate trouble before removing any unit Many times a component is removed from the
aircraft only to find it is not defective after reliable tests. Therefore. before removing a unit in a defective
cranking system. the following checks should be made
a
Determine the condition of the batterV
b
Inspect the viring for frayed insulation or other damage Replace any wiring that is damaged
Inspect all connections to the cranking motor. solenoid or magnetic switch. ignition switch or an! other
control switch. and battery. including all ground connections Clean and tighten all connections and wmring
as required Man! engine manufacturers specify allowable voltage drops in the cranking circuit For this
information. refer to the engine manufacturer's shop manual
c
Inspect all control switches and the ignition switch. to determine their condition. Connect a jumper
lead around any switch suspected of being defective If the system functions properl! using this method, repair
or replace the bypassed switch
d.
If specified batter! voltage can be measured at the motor terminal of the cranking motor. allowing
for some voltage drop in the circuit and the engine is known to be functioning properly. remove the motor and
follow the test procedures
9-65 Test And Maintenance Of Cranking Motor. (Delco-Remy)
9-66 Inspection. With the cranking motor removed from the engine. the pinion should be checked for
freedom of operation by turning it on the screw shaft The armature should be checked for freedom of
operation b\ turning the pinion Tight. dirty. or worn bearings. bent armature shaft. or loose pole shoe screw
will cause the armature to drag and it w ill not turn freely If the armature does not turn freel the motor should
be disassembled immediately. However. if the armature does operate freely. the motor should be given
electrical tests before disassembly (Refer to Paragraph 9-73 )
